Standard concept map for matter:
Matter
├── Has mass
├── Occupies space (but “space” isn’t in word bank)
├── Can be classified as:
│ ├── Pure Substance
│ │ ├── Element
│ │ └── Compound
│ └── Mixture
├── Exists in states:
│ ├── Solid
│ ├── Liquid
│ └── Gas
└── Undergoes changes:
├── Physical Change
└── Chemical Change
